4,295,007,820 (four billion two hundred ninety-five million seven thousand eight hundred twenty) is an even 10-digit number. It is a composite number with 24 divisors, and factors as 2² × 5 × 107 × 2,007,013. Its proper divisors sum to 4,808,807,684, more than the number itself, making it an abundant number.
